Extended Provision Assistant (Before and After School club) job summary
Extended Provision AssistantJoin Our Extended Provision Team
We are seeking a caring, enthusiastic and reliable Extended Provision Assistant to join our friendly school team and support the day-to-day running of our Breakfast and After School Club.
This is a fantastic opportunity for someone who enjoys working with children and is passionate about providing high-quality, safe and engaging play opportunities in a nurturing school environment.
About the RoleAs an Extended Provision Assistant, you will play a key role in supporting the planning, organisation and smooth operation of our out-of-school provision. You will help create a welcoming and inclusive environment where children feel safe, supported and able to enjoy a range of creative and active play experiences.
You will work closely with the extended provision lead and wider school team, and may be required to deputise when needed.
Key Responsibilities Include:- Supporting the delivery of high-quality care and creative play opportunities
- Helping to ensure a safe, welcoming and well-organised environment for all children
- Supporting children’s individual needs and promoting positive behaviour
- Assisting with safe handover and collection of children
- Preparing simple food and drink in line with healthy eating and food safety standards
- Supporting safeguarding, first aid, risk assessments and health & safety procedures
- Assisting with record keeping and basic administration
- Building positive relationships with children, parents/carers and staff
- Working as part of the wider school team to promote the club
- Deputising for the Playleader when required
We offer flexible working patterns within our Extended Provision:
- Breakfast Club: Monday to Friday, 7:45am - 8:45am
- After School Club: Monday to Thursday, 3:15pm - 6:00pm
Various combinations of hours available (mornings and/or after school sessions)

We are a thriving, two-form entry primary school located in Wantage, Oxfordshire.
All of the staff at Charlton strive to give each child the best start for them to be confident, happy and successful lifelong learners, preparing them for the next stage in their school life. The planning and teaching of our curriculum reflects our ethos and school values.
"Be Happy, Be Kind, Be Responsible"
Teachers and Teaching Assistants are dedicated in supporting children to master the foundations of reading, writing and mathematics, as well as ensuring that our broad and exciting curriculum enables everyone the opportunity to find their passion and develop their talents. We aim to achieve excellence through enjoyment!
Those who work at Charlton are enthusiastic, passionate and nurturing, and they recognise the importance of the role they play in each child’s life; inspiring them to be the best that they can be. The school is also committed to developing the practice of their staff, to ensure they can have the greatest impact on the children we care for.
We are very lucky to have an extensive and beautiful outdoor space that provides valuable opportunities to develop a healthy, active lifestyle and for children to learn how to care for our environment and its importance.
Everything we do at Charlton is centred around our values - Be happy, Be kind and Be responsible. This helps to develop a nurturing, positive and friendly environment for all.
